What is ISO 8404 about?
ISO 8404 is a standard that covers dimensional specifications for angle pins that enhances the structural integrity of angle pins according to global standards.
ISO 8404 specifies the basic dimensions, in millimetres, of headed angle pins (type A), straight angle pins (type B), angle pins mounted with external thread (type C) and angle pins mounted with hexagon socket head cap screw (type D), intended for use in diecasting dyes and tools for moulding.
ISO 8404 also specifies the material hardness and designation of the angle pins (types A, B, C and D).

Why should you use ISO 8404?
Angle Pins are made from tough material that has good wear resistance. They are used in conjunction with core slide retainer to actuate sliding core blocks. To prevent grinding after installation, the heads are machined with a spherical radius.

What’s changed since the last update?
BS ISO 8404:2021 supersedes BS ISO 8404:2013, which is now withdrawn.
Changes in BS ISO 8404:2021 include –
- Addition of two new types of angle pins: angle pins mounted with external thread (type C) and angle pins mounted with hexagon socket head cap screw (type D)
- Correction in Figure 1
- Addition of an indication of surface roughness under the head of headed angle pins (Figure 2)
